Need is high for pharmaceutical quality THC and various cannabinoids as a result of desire in their potential therapeutic use, but is stymied by legal laws of C. sativa cultivation in lots of international locations.[thirteen] Immediate chemical synthesis of THC is difficult as a result of high charges and small yields.[fourteen] Thus, the usage of THCA synthase to the production of THC continues to be explored, as CBGA is simple to synthesize and THCA conveniently decarboxylates to kind THC.

The literature contains a series of foundational reviews covering the chemistry of cannabinoids that contextualize the development of the sector. Farnsworth’s 1969 review addresses botanical considerations of “marihuana,” the biological evaluation on the plant and extracts, the known chemical constituents, and the strategy for his or her identification (Farnsworth 1969). Mechoulam’s 1970 influential review on “marihuana chemistry” reviewed nomenclature and the chemical and the then-proposed biogenic synthesis of cannabinoids (Mechoulam 1970). In 1975, Shoyama et al. in their “biosynthesis of cannabinoid acids” mentioned prospective pathways used to synthesize cannabinoic acids from cannabigerolic acid (Shoyama et al. 1975).
